The ongoing transition from Universal Analytics to Google Analytics 4 (GA4) has posed significant challenges for marketers, developers, and agency owners. Many are grappling with the complexities of GA4's data model and wondering how best to adapt their analytics strategies to this new landscape. Additionally, with increasing scrutiny over data privacy and compliance regulations like GDPR and UK PECR, the need for a privacy-first approach to data-driven marketing has never been more vital.
The Challenges of GA4
- Complex Data Structure: Unlike its predecessor, GA4 focuses on event-based tracking rather than session-based tracking, which can leave users confused about how to optimally set up their analytics.
- Reduced Clarity: Many users have reported that GA4 provides “more data” but leads to less decision clarity, making it difficult to derive actionable insights.
- Compliance Pitfalls: With Europe's stringent privacy laws, ensuring compliance is critical. Navigating GA4's features for consent management and data anonymisation can be daunting.

What is Google Analytics 4?
Google Analytics 4 is the latest version of Google's web analytics platform, designed to provide user-centric event data tracking for enhanced insights into user behaviour across web and app platforms.

What is cookieless tracking?
Cookieless tracking is an analytics method that gathers user interaction data without relying on cookies, thereby reducing privacy concerns and improving compliance with data protection laws.
